Subject: Possible Acquisition — Heads-Up for Sales Leads

Team, the executive group at Fennwick Labs is in early talks to acquire Solvaire Metrics. Nothing is signed, and customer conversations should not reference this. Keep current Solvaire competitive plays active until told otherwise. Expect a briefing once diligence wraps. Direct any partner questions to me rather than speculating. The confidential planning detail is included just below.

internal memo for yajef-tajeg: The renewal with Ralaelek Group closes at $2 million a year, 15 percent above the last contract. Project Zorix slips by two quarters because of the tooling delay.

As the assigned code reviewer, you'll need vault access to verify that the extracted service's migration scripts match what's sealed inside — please diff them carefully, since the identity tables are involved and any mismatch could orphan session records.

Per the runbook, the vault accepts one recovery attempt per hour; when prompted, enter the recovery passphrase written below.

unlock words, yawig-kagef: gordor-holvan-ulaael-pramir-ulaiel-tamdor

## Local Setup — Twigreaper

Twigreaper is the stale-branch cleanup bot for the Hollowfen monorepo. Clone, run `make deps`, then `make seed` to load fixture branches. Requires a local Postgres on the default port. Dry-run mode is on by default; flip `PRUNE_FOR_REAL` only after review. Tests assume the seeded state, so rerun `make seed` between suites. Point the bot at the fixture database with the following.

primary connection of yagep-kahip = redis://giliel_svc:zYiKsLL2PLpfPL@db-348f.xolmarsys.corp:5432/fenwyn

Finance Review Summary — Meridale Expansion

For the incoming director: Meridale region entry is funded at 2.1m, phased over three quarters. Leasehold and staffing consume 70%; remainder covers launch marketing for the Fernline product. Breakeven modelled at month fourteen. Risks: currency exposure and slower permit timelines. Treasury has hedged half the exposure. Our intended approach for the region is set out below.

internal memo for kawip-hadug: Headcount on the Wenwyn team goes from 7 to 140 by the end of January. Gross margin on Wenwyn came in at 20 percent against a plan of 15 percent.